Ok so I'm taking the plunge. This is my first progress pic side by side. I had an RNY bypass in August 17 so 10 months and a bit before on my own. My start weight was 187kg and size 32. Now 87kg and size 16. 100kg lost feels pretty good. Next is skin!Collage%202018-07-03%2023_49_01.jpeg

      Two months out from hiatal hernia repair.  Surgeon said to expect a lot more flatulence...something about the 'air' no longer being able to 'burp' out so comes out the other end.  That is my experience but have no understanding of why that swallowed air cannot be 'burped'. ???
      · 1 reply
      1. BlondePatriotInCDA

        As I understand it since your stomach is smaller and not completely resting against your diaphragm anymore you no longer have the ability to "push" burps out as well. Plus, since its smaller and we don't digest slower the trapped air moves a lot quicker out of the stomach so its no longer available to burp out. Hence the other option for removal.
